Trick Will Parts



Recognizing the vital components of a will is vital for efficient estate planning, as it guarantees your wishes are clearly expressed and legally promoted. You need to recognize your recipients-- those who will certainly receive your assets. Next, select an administrator that'll handle your estate and ensure your instructions are complied with. It's also essential to specify just how your debts and taxes will certainly be paid. Furthermore, think about consisting of guardianship stipulations if you have small youngsters, detailing who'll care for them. Make sure your will is authorized and seen according to your state's legislations to make it legitimate. By resolving these elements, you produce a strong foundation for your estate plan, supplying satisfaction for you and your enjoyed ones.

Common False Impressions Dealt With



Lots of people hold false impressions concerning wills that can avoid them from taking vital action in estate planning. One usual misconception is that only the rich demand a will, yet everyone can take advantage of having one, despite their financial situation. One more false impression is that a will instantly avoids probate, yet it doesn't; it simply provides direction on exactly how to disperse your assets. Many also believe that wills are only for the senior, yet unexpected occasions can take place at any age. In addition, some think they can develop a will certainly without specialist assistance, but consulting a lawyer guarantees it's legally sound and shows your desires. Frequently Asked Inquiries



Can I Modification My Will After It's Been Created?



Yes, you can transform your will certainly after it's been produced. Just guarantee you comply with the legal demands for alterations, like drafting a brand-new will or including a codicil, to maintain your desires clear and legitimate.


What Occurs if I Don't Have a Power of Attorney?



If you don't have a power of attorney, you run the risk of leaving important choices in the hands of the court. It might assign someone you would not pick, potentially complicating your treatment and financial management when required.


Just how Commonly Should I Testimonial My Estate Strategy?



You need to review your estate strategy every couple of years or after major life modifications, like marriage, separation, or the birth of a kid. Regular updates ensure your dreams show your current scenario and preferences.
